Ending Choices - Spare Or Kill Lord Shimura?
Choice Appears In The Last Mission

You are given the choice to either spare or kill Lord Shimura after you defeat him. This scene happens after you win the last duel of the game in the story mission, "The Tale of Lord Shimura". Both choices differ as they affect the armor you receive at the end of the game.

New Skin Depending On Your Choice

After making your decision and watching the credits, you will be rewarded with a new skin for your Ghost Armor set. Both skins do not provide any benefits or perks, they are simply cosmetic items.

Ending Dialogue & Cutscene Changes
Jin Assumes The Ghost Identity

Choosing either killing or sparing both ends with Jin being branded as a traitor. This then leads him to fully embrace his identity as the Ghost.
Post-Credits Scene Changes

After the credits roll, the scene where you resume control of Jin is also slightly different for both choices. If you chose to spare Lord Shimura, the scene starts with Jin writing a letter. If you chose to kill Lord Shimura, the scene will start with Jin sitting on the floor.

Jin's Adoptive Father

After the death of Jin's father, Lord Shimura took Jin in as his adopted son. The two bonded together throughout the years with Lord Shimura teaching Jin about the principles of honor and swordsmanship.
Strict & Honor-Bound

The final conflict of the story stems from Lord Shimura's strict adherence to honor. He was given orders by the Shogun himself to dispatch Jin due to his "dishonorable" actions while repelling the Mongol invaders. This ultimately leads to the final and touching duel of the game.
